Prosperity and Poverty - Both are Gods

 There comes a time, or times in a persons' life when all of the effort put into a thing doesn't bring the result that it should, or is expected to. Every other time it worked very well, but this time it seems a waste of time. This time there seems to be no evidence of progress, or very little at all. Haggai heard from the Lord in this matter. Gradually, over time the effort of the People shifted to well being of the People, instead of the Glory of God.

God isn't necessarily angry. God simply wants us to be forever reminded that in the busy efforts to make accomidations for our own well being, we must never forget the ultimate importance of Glorifying God.

I see all around me that my fellow brothers and sisters in Christ do prosper. The Word said it would be this way. When we are in the center of our prosperity, we must NOT EVER forget the source of our success. We must NOT EVER forget that our prosperity is the result, NOT the goal!

A very short while ago I did have everything that my heart desired. I had a wife. I had a son. I had a very nice house. I was content. I was very content. I forgot to Glorify God. Listen, I went to the church every morning at 4:00am to clean the church, to study, and to remember to give God the praise. I fell short, even in the center of the effort. God didn't remove my substance because I forgot to Glorify Him. He just doesn't do things for a single reason or result. There are always dynamic, or multiple reasons and results when God moves in our lives.

Not only do I need to acknowledge Him, Glorify Him, and praise Him, but I also need to relate to the very people I am sharing this with. My heart was strong for the homeless and the chemically dependant people in my town. It wasn't enough to go from door to door, sharing the love of Jesus. I needed to see where they are hurting, by hurting there in that same place, myself. God will use the people who are willing to be used. We are the body of Christ. Individual members of the body. The hand, the foot, the eye... some are the heart... but Jesus is the head.

Don't be afraid to go into the wilderness, even if you feel like you done everything just as God wanted you to do it. Sometimes we need to become familiar with a path that isn't ours, so that we can help a fellow find the way. There is nobody so lost that they can't be found. Trust in God, even if things look really bad. Encourage yourself in worship. Delight yourself in praise. Acknowledge the Lord and He will direct your path!
